The Tang people believe in the god Chenghuang very much.

But the original city god was not a god, but only the moat of the city.

The ancients first believed that the god of the ditch was the god of water, and later gradually became the guardian city on the outskirts of the city, the god of the city god.

It has even become a god in Taoism to cut off evil and protect the country and protect the country, saying that he can respond to people's invitations, rain when it is dry, sunny when it is waterlogged, and protect the grain and the people.

Moreover, it is said that the god of the city god is the lord of a city in the underworld.
